Give step one of the Urea cycle
CO2 + NH3 is converted to Carbamoyl phosphate by Carbamoyl phosphate synthase. This consumes 2ATP to form ADP + Pi.
Give step two of the urea cycle
Carbamoyl phosphate is converted to Citrulline by Ornithine Carbamoyl transferase. One phosphate is released.
Give step three of the urea cycle
Citrulline is combined with L-Aspartate to to form Argininosuccinate by Argininosuccinate synthase. One ATP is consumed to form AMP and PPi.
Give step four of the Urea cycle
Argininosuccinate is converted to L-Arginine by Argininosuccinate lyase, and fumrate is released.
Give step five (last) of the urea cycle.
L-Arginine is converted to L-Ornithine by Arginase. A water molecule is consumed and Urea released.
